Subject: Floor 6 open Monday

Assistants — Floor 6 of Corven Tower opens Monday. Desk bookings go through the usual portal from Friday. Lifts serve Floor 6 from 07:00; stairwell door stays locked until badges sync, expected Wednesday. Meeting rooms 6A–6C bookable now; 6D is AV-only. Report snags to facilities, not the front desk. Until badge sync completes, the stairwell keypad takes the code below.

door code, yagap-bahof: bdg-O-05

## Service Accounts: tailr CLI

The `tailr` CLI streams logs from the Fernbrook aggregator. Release managers use the shared `svc-release-tailr` account; do not use personal accounts for release verification. Scope is read-only, logs older than 72 hours are unavailable. Config lives at `~/.tailr/config.toml`. The account authenticates with the key below.

API key for yahig-tadup: kto7_ubizbYm

## Local Setup: Thumbnail Queue

Heads up — the Snapcrate thumbnail queue won't start without the worker daemon running first, so kick that off before anything else. Clone the repo, run the bootstrap script, and seed the sample images from the fixtures folder. The queue drains every five seconds locally, which is slower than staging but fine for smoke tests. If thumbnails come out blank, it's almost always a missing codec — rerun bootstrap. Once the worker is up, point it at the jobs database using the string below.

primary connection of yagep-kahip = redis://giliel_svc:zYiKsLL2PLpfPL@db-348f.xolmarsys.corp:5432/fenwyn

Ticket: Staging env misconfigured for Siftgate bloom filter

The bloom layer in front of the Pellet KV store is rejecting all lookups in staging because the env file was copied from the dev template without credentials. False-positive tuning values are fine; only the auth line is missing. To unblock the weekly demo, the Pellet admission secret must be set on the following line.

env line for yaguf-fajop: LEDGER_TOKEN13=fb08984397349